Here is proof as to why no-one can get the 'eckbox' working. Quotes from eckbox hardware pages: "Notes on AD converter selection: pick out a 1 channel, 8 bit converter with an insanely high number of samples per second. 1 GSPS if possible" and quote "to find out which pins are the 8 digital outputs. Connect these to pins 2-9 of your 25 pin parallel port extender cable. Be sure that output lead #8 goes to pin #9 on your parallel cable, #7 goes to #8 and soforth. " Without even building the hardware or looking at the software i know their method will not work because of the above two quotes. >From those quotes you see there is no handshaking or buffer between the 'eckbox' and the PC this means the software simply records everything that comes across the lpt port. the max sample rate you can get out of a high speed lpt port is 1m/s (under idea conditions) their hardware guys say get the fastest sampling ADC available even suggests 1GSPS the lpt card can only handle 1MSPS. Which means the so called 'Eckbox device' is clearly missing about 999000000 samples per second. It is only seeing a random and sometimes between ADC sampling cycles (bad data)10% of the data inputted from the 'eckbox'. I don't care what kind of software you are using it simply wont work since no software can accurately guess what 90% of the data is suppose to be..
